Section 62 in West Bengal Municipal (Building) Rules, 2007

62. Bathroom and water closet.

— (1) No bathroom shall have a floor area of less than 1.8 sq. metres and width less than 1.2 metres and a height less than 2.2 metres measured from the surface of a floor to the lowest point of the ceiling or the underside of any slabProvided that if it is a combined bathroom and a water closet, such floor area shall not be less than 2.6 sq. metres.
(2)No water closet shall have a floor area of less than 1.2 sq. metres and a width less than 1.0 metre.
(3)Notwithstanding the provisions of sub-rule (1) or sub-rule (2), in the case of any building referred to in rule 56.
(a)an independent bathroom may have a floor area of 1.45 metres;
(b)a combined bathroom and water closet may have a floor area of 2.0 sq. metres, with a minimum width of 1.1 metres.
(4)Every bathroom or water closet shall—
(a)be so situated that at least one of its walls shall open to an interior open space or exterior open space or shaft and shall have an opening in the form of window or ventilator or louvre not less than 0.40 sq. metre in area;
(b)not be directly over any room, other than a latrine or water closet or a washing place or a bathroom or a terrace, unless it has a water tight floor;
(c)have the platform or seat made of water tight non-absorbent materials;
(d)be enclosed by walls or partitions and the surface of every such wall or partition shall be finished with a smooth impervious material to a height of not less than 1 metre above the floor of such a room;
(e)be provided with a door completely closing the entrance to it; and
(f)be provided with an impervious floor covering sloping towards any drain with a suitable grade and not towards any verandah or other MOM.
(5)No room containing any water closet shall be used for any purpose except as a lavatory and no such room shall open directly into any kitchen or cooking space or pantry by a door, window or other opening.
